Understanding the Basics of Down Payments:

  1. What is a Down Payment?: A down payment is a percentage of the home's purchase price that the buyer pays upfront. It is not included in the mortgage loan and serves as a sign of commitment to the purchase.

  2. Minimum Requirements: The minimum down payment required can vary depending on the type of mortgage loan and the lender's policies. In Houston, as in the rest of the U.S., the typical minimum down payment ranges from 3% to 20% or more.

Factors Influencing Down Payments:

  1. Mortgage Type: Different mortgage programs have varying down payment requirements. For example, FHA loans often require a lower down payment (around 3.5%), while conventional loans may require (typically 3% to 5%) VA Loans and USDA loans are zero down.

  2. Credit Score: Your credit score can influence the down payment amount. A higher credit score may enable you to qualify for loans with lower down payment requirements.

  3. Property Price: The cost of the property you're interested in will directly impact the size of your down payment. More expensive homes necessitate larger down payments.

Strategies for Managing Down Payments:

  1. Save Aggressively: Start saving for your down payment as early as possible. Create a dedicated savings account and set a monthly savings goal.

  2. Explore Assistance Programs: In Houston, there are various down payment assistance programs available to qualified buyers. Special Programs such as Hero Incentives, First Time Home buyers programs and grants can help narrow your closing cost down tremendously.

The Advantages of a Larger Down Payment:

  1. Lower Monthly Payments: A larger down payment can lead to smaller monthly mortgage payments.

  2. Reduced Interest Costs: A substantial down payment can save you money over the life of the loan by reducing interest costs.

  3. Improved Loan Terms: Lenders may offer more favorable terms, such as lower interest rates, for borrowers with larger down payments.
